Analysis of the diagnostic methods and etiological factors in patients with fever of unknown origin

Yin Shen

Open publisher page 0 citations

Abstract

Objective To analyze the diagnostic methods and etiological factors in patients with fever of unknown origin (FUO).Methods The clinical data of 358 patients with FUO,Who were treated in hospital since February 2001 to April 2005,were retrospectively analyzed.Results Among the 358 patients,312 patients were definitely agnosed(87.2%),A- mong the 312 definitely diagnosis patients,172 cases were infectious disease(132 cases were bacterial infection,31 cases were virus infection,6 eases were fungus infection and 3 cases belonged to other disese),143 cases were bacterial were non-infections disease(66 cases were collagen vascular diseases,63 cases were malignant tumor and 14 cases belonged to other disese).46 cases remained origin-unknown until they were discharged from hospital.Conclusion In the diag- nosis of FUO,We should manage to collect oathogenic,immunologic and pathologic evidences.Infectious diseases,collagen vascular diseases and malignant tumors are the main causes of FUO.
